Carlos Guimarães Pinto stated that it has already become clear that Chega wants to present the motion of censure against the Government, but does not want it to be approved. This declaration comes in the context of a discussion about the decision of André Ventura's party to advance with the motion of censure against Montenegro's Executive.

Miguel Morgado, Carlos Guimarães Pinto, and Cristina Rodrigues were the participants in this discussion about Chega's strategy. The debate focused on André Ventura's intention and what has failed in Montenegro's Executive governance so far.

The motion of censure represents a political tool used by Chega to pressure the Government, although Carlos Guimarães Pinto's comments suggest that the party does not really intend to bring down the Executive, but rather to use the motion as an instrument of political pressure.

The episode reflects the dynamics between the Portuguese right-wing parties and the existing tensions in governance, with Chega seeking to mark its position through this parliamentary initiative, while maintaining a strategic position regarding the voting outcomes.

Miranda do Corvo invests more than 2 thousand euros in school transport with new car seats

The Miranda do Corvo Municipal Council invested more than 2,200 euros in the acquisition of 40 car seats and 20 'baby' seats for the municipal buses used in school transport. The measure arose in response to concerns raised by parents and guardians during meetings held in all schools of the municipality, within the framework of a proximity process with the educational community. The municipal council stated that the investment is part of a broader strategy to enhance quality of life in the territory, with the aim of strengthening the safety and comfort of children and facilitating the daily lives of families.

Junta de Espinhosela rejects new deer cull and calls for measures to protect chestnut trees

The Junta de Freguesia de Espinhosela rejected a new authorization for deer culling and requested protection measures for chestnut trees, after deer attacked plantations last week, warning of the damage caused to local agricultural activity.

Sánchez affirms that Ceuta and Melilla will be Spanish territory "forever"

Spanish Prime Minister, Pedro Sánchez, reiterated this Thursday in the Congress of Deputies that Ceuta and Melilla are Spanish territory "forever," providing clarification about the migration crisis that occurred at the end of July, when Morocco allowed a sudden flow of migrants toward Ceuta. The Spanish Prime Minister emphasized Spain's unwavering position regarding the two autonomous cities, at a time when diplomatic relations with Morocco remain tense.

Strasbourg declares that Spain violated the right to assembly of those convicted for the siege of Parliament in 2011

The European Court of Human Rights declared that Spain violated the right to assembly of four people convicted for the episode known as the "siege of Parliament" in 2011, when demonstrations surrounded the Parliament of Catalonia and prevented the arrival of deputies and then president Artur Mas, in protest of the economic crisis of the time. Although the court considered the violation of the right to assembly, it did not consider that the convicted should be compensated.
